Marussia driver Jules Bianchi has been taken to hospital after a crash at the Japanese Grand Prix.
The Frenchman lost control at the same spot at which recovery vehicles were attending the Sauber of Adrian Sutil, who had crashed on the previous lap.
The race was red-flagged once Race Control had been alerted to the severity of Bianchi's injuries.
The FIA said Bianchi was unconscious as he was taken from the Suzuka track. No further update on Bianchi's condition has since been issued.
In wet conditions, the 25-year-old's incident happened shortly after the rain intensified.
Bianchi, a member of Ferrari's young driver programme, is in his second season in F1.
He scored a memorable ninth place in Monaco this year, giving the back-of-the grid Marussia team their first points since their debut in 2010.
